When working with Chinese vendors ahead of major holidays such as in the lead-up to Spring Festival or the Black Friday and Christmas ordering wave, effective dialogue grows harder yet more essential. Many suppliers are overwhelmed with orders, employees are on vacation, and response times can slow down significantly. To maintain smooth operations, it is important to plan ahead and adapt your communication style.


Start by reaching out early—don’t wait until the last minute. Set clear deadlines for production, delivery, and logistics upfront. This enables them to plan staffing and inventory effectively.


Use precise, unambiguous language. Refrain from vague phrases such as "Can this be done faster?". Instead, say "The inspection report must be submitted no later than October 15 to ensure on-time shipment.".


Use simple language and avoid idioms or slang that might not translate well. While some are proficient, others rely on translation tools.


Cultivating mutual trust and professional respect yields lasting results. Appreciate their dedication, offer sincere thanks, and remain patient when obstacles arise.


Frequent, polite updates through WeChat or email maintain momentum respectfully.


Never assume understanding—always verify receipt and secure written agreement.


If possible, assign a single point of contact on both sides to avoid confusion.
